Cognitive Behavioral Therapy (CBT)
CBT has become among the most efficient healing techniques to stress management. This therapy assists individuals recognize and alter unhelpful mindsets and behaviors adding to stress. By employing techniques such as cognitive restructuring, clients discover to challenge unfavorable ideas, improving emotional strength.
Mindfulness-Based Therapy
Mindfulness-based therapy concentrates on cultivating present-moment awareness and approval. Through exercises like mindful breathing and directed meditation, people establish a greater understanding of their thoughts and emotions, resulting in reduced stress levels.
Art Therapy
Art therapy offers a distinct outlet for individuals to express their feelings artistically. This therapeutic method helps clients communicate thoughts or sensations that might be challenging to reveal verbally. Activities such as painting, drawing, or sculpting can supply therapeutic relief and insight.
Play Therapy
Mostly used for children, play therapy employs play as a way of communication and recovery. Here, kids can express their emotions and experiences through play, enabling therapists to comprehend their struggles much better.
Group Therapy
Group therapy offers a supportive environment where people can share their experiences with others dealing with comparable challenges. Facilitated by a therapist, seminar foster neighborhood and help in reducing feelings of seclusion that typically accompany stress.
Psychodynamic Therapy
Psychodynamic therapy serves to check out the deeper, frequently unconscious, patterns that contribute to stress. By analyzing the previous experiences that shape existing behaviors, individuals can get insight and work towards healthier coping systems.
Solution-Focused Brief Therapy (SFBT)

Signs of Stress and Potential Impacts
Understanding the signs of stress is crucial for determining when therapeutic intervention might be essential. Typical signs of stress can include:
- Physical Symptoms: Headaches, tiredness, muscle tension, and gastrointestinal issues.
- Emotional Symptoms: Anxiety, irritability, mood swings, and sensations of overwhelm.
- Behavioral Symptoms: Changes in sleep patterns, social withdrawal, compound use, and modifications in appetite.
Overlooking stress with time can result in serious health implications, including anxiety disorders, depression, cardiovascular illness, and a weakened immune system. Early intervention is important for cultivating total well-being.
FAQs About Therapy for Stress
1. What are the advantages of therapy for stress?
Therapy supplies people with coping methods, emotional support, self-awareness, and suggests for reliable stress management.
2. For how long does therapy for stress take?
The period varies depending upon the person's needs, therapy type, and their specific objectives. Some might need a couple of sessions, while others take advantage of long-lasting therapy.
3. Can therapy be integrated with medication?
Yes, therapy can be efficiently combined with medication. A doctor can help figure out the best approach based on specific situations.
4. How do I pick the ideal type of therapy for my stress?
Choosing the right therapy includes understanding the specific elements of stress experienced. Consulting with a mental health professional can help tailor the approach to private requirements.
5. Is therapy reliable for everybody?
While therapy is an important tool, its efficiency can vary from individual to person. A person's determination to participate in the procedure and work on their problems plays a substantial function in healing success.
6. What should I expect throughout my first therapy session?
Throughout the first session, a therapist will normally gather background information, comprehend your current struggles, and discuss your goals for therapy.
